Where Does the Name Allen Come From?
Allen is widely believed to have Celtic and Gaelic roots, often linked to the meaning “little rock” or “harmony.” Some etymologists also connect it to old Germanic influences suggesting “noble” or “precious.” Over time, the name spread through Britain and Ireland before becoming common across Europe and eventually the United States, where it has remained a steady favorite for generations.
While Allen does not appear as a direct name in the original biblical texts, its core meanings — rock, harmony, and nobility — are deeply woven into scriptural language and themes. This is why so many believers feel a strong spiritual connection to the name, even though it isn’t found word-for-word in the Bible.

Common Variations and Nicknames of Allen
The name Allen has several closely related spellings and nicknames that share the same roots and meaning, including Alan, Allan, Allyn, and the shortened form Al. Each version carries the same essence of strength, harmony, and nobility, even with slightly different spellings depending on cultural or regional preferences.
